XOTech 10-21-2003, 01:28 AM You may note that the McLarens posted by Auto Salon resurface about once a year or so. They are consignment cars (or were) perhaps long ago, but are reintroduced for publicity. I have been to their facility. They have quite a number of fairly high end cars, but they are all consignment cars. I will certainly give the possibility that they must own at least a few, but none of the cars I expressed interest in or have discussed with them at length were directly owned by Auto Salon. Of the McLarens that I expressed interst in for clients, I found them to be quite illusive and non-productive in providing any relevant or detailed information.
